The Caylee Anthony Case
Caylee Anthony disappeared in June 2008 and was later on found dead attracting major attention. Her mother, Casey Anthony is suspected to have murdered her own daughter. By using forensic science and psychology they investigated further into the case. For example, the police questioned Caylee’s grandmother who at first said that the trunk of Casey’s car had the odor of a dead body. What does the future hold?
Advances in the technology used in examining the crime scenes have turned forensic psychology into a rapidly growing career field. In the near future forensic psychology will change in many ways. For instance, it will advance in education, research, and finally practice. Forensic psychology is somewhat underdeveloped because it is still progressing as a field of study and as a career. As it develops though so will the interest in it.
